Heron Hall School First of Eight to be Connected to Energetik Heat Network under PSDS Project

Heron Hall School in Ponders End has successfully been connected to Energetik’s district heating network, becoming the first of eight schools scheduled to connect over the next two years as part of a wider Public Sector Decarbonisation Scheme (PSDS) programme running through to 2028. Futureproof heat network to serve Enfield for decades to come

The construction of Energetik heat networks continues to make progress across Enfield. Pipework is already in the ground at satellite schemes serving hundreds of customers at Ponders End, Arnos Grove and New Avenue, with the heat network installation at Meridian Water well underway.
